Cesario returned to the Committee room Item # 12 FILE NUMBER: A042/15 TORONTO JEWISH ACADEMY OHR MENACHEM Part of Lot 29, Concession 1, (Part of Lots 66 and 67, Registrar s Compiled Plan 9834 and Lot 4, Registered Plan 2132, municipally known as 7608 Yonge Street, Thornhill). The subject lands are zoned RA3, Apartment Residential Zone and subject to the provisions of Exception 9(1150) under By-law 1-88 as amended. To permit the maintenance of an existing club within commercial units 3, 4, 5 & 6. BACKGROUND INFORMATION: 1. To expand the definition for a Club to include some religious and educational activities in addition to social, cultural and welfare programs. 1. Religious and educational activities (institutional uses) are not permitted uses under the definition for Club. Other Planning Act Applications The land which is the subject in this application was also the subject of another application under the Planning Act: Consent Application: B003/13 - APPROVED, March 21, 2013 - creation of a new lot Minor Variance Applications: A152/14 APPROVED, June 12, 2014 permit a parking ration of 2.0 parking spaces per 100m2 for a club use only. A061/13 APPROVED, March 21, 2013 permit one single family dwelling to be constructed in a RA3, Apartment Residential Zone A134/11 - APPROVED, May 26, 2011: Construction of a 4 & 6 storey mixed use building and the relocation and restoration of the historic Robert Cox House. A271/10 APPROVED, Nov. 25, 2010: Definition of residential suite, min. parking requirements and max. encroachment for canopies. A164/03 APPROVED, June 26, 2003: Min parking spaces 79; Max. GFA of eating establishment uses 31% of total GFA. A130/01 APPROVED, AS AMENDED - June 14, 2001, parking spaces of 76, and front landscape strip varying from 0.0m to 6.0m., for Buildings B & C only. Site Plan Application: DA.08.024 - APPROVED to implement the development of the lands (File PL070942) DA.01.011 APPROVED -to permit additions to the building located at 7610 and 7616 Yonge Street Z.05.011 APPROVED by OMB (File # PL070942) permits a 6 storey mixed use bldg. along Yonge St. that steps down to 4 storeys for that portion of the building to the west of the relocated Robert Cox House. Also permits a single detached dwelling on a portion of the lands that front Arnold Ave. Official Plan Amendment OP.05.004 APPROVED by OMB (File # PL070942) Deborah Alexander and Evan Perlman, Weston Consulting, the agent appeared along with the applicant Rabbi Mendal Zaltzman and gave a brief submission regarding the request. Roy Murad, 15 Mill Street and residents from unit # s 115, 443, 628 and 711 7608 Yonge Street appeared in support of the request. Michael Steinburg counsel to the Board of the Directions, Jerry Epstien, President of the Board of Directors York Region Standard Condominium Corporation No. 1268, 7608 Yonge Street Suite 414, Harold Milstein, 22 Arnold Avenue, residents from unit # s 108, 527, 621 & PH15 8608 Yonge Street and Behdad Biglar, 95 Confederation Way appeared in opposition to the request. Request for decision forms were received from Michael Steinberg, 77 King Street West, Suite 3000, Toronto, ON M5K 1G8, Italia Venutolo, 7608 Yonge Street Suite 108, Thornhill, ON L4J 1V9, Shah Makeki, 7608 Yonge Street Suite 623, Thornhill, ON L4J 0J5 and Alexander Zalezwk, 195 Gamble Road, Richmond Hill, ON L4S 7K7. The Committee is of the opinion that the variance sought cannot be considered minor and is not desirable for the appropriate development and use of the land. The general intent and purpose of the Bylaw and the Official Plan will not be maintained. Page 10 of 13

Seconded by J. Cesario THAT Application No. A042/15, TORONTO JEWISH ACADEMY OHR MENACHEM, be REFUSED. Item # 13 FILE NUMBER: A043/15 BACKGROUND INFORMATION: 2109179 ONTARIO INC.
